Is the Middle East War Armageddon?

Is the Middle East War Armageddon?
with Dr. Douglas Knight


When Biblical predictions resemble today's evening newscasts does it taint the way we interpret world events or does it help shape them? Dr. Douglas Knight, Director of the Center for Religion and Culture at Vanderbilt discusses Biblical prophecies and the current uprisings in the Middle East.

Psychology of Stigmata with Mario Martinez

Psychology of Stigmata:
How the Mind Wounds and Heals
with Mario Martinez, Psy.D.


Mario Martinez, Psy. D and author discusses the biocognitive connection between belief, faith, emotion and the power of guilt in the spiritual mind awakening, citing results from recent investigations into stigmata cases for the Catholic Church and National Geographic.

The Art of Amazement

The Art of Amazement
with Rabbi Alexander Seinfeld

Can one learn the art of amazement...to live life from a constant state of awe and spiritual awareness? Rabbi Alexander Seinfeld offers a step by step guide to the untapped wisdom of Jewish mysticism, offering practical applications that can lead to major shifts in one's personal perceptions on life and love.
